Name the characteristic of sound which can distinguish between the 'notes' (musical sounds) played on a flute and a sitar (both the notes having the same pitch and loudness).
Advertisements
उत्तर
Quality or timbre is the characteristic of the sound by which we can distinguish between the ‘notes’ played on a flute and a sitar.
